Nig Perrine
John Grover "Nig" Perrine was an American professional baseball infielder.
Perrine started his professional baseball career in 1902, at the age of 17. In 1906, he batting [average (baseball)|batted].308 in the American Association and was purchased by the Washington Senators of the American League. However, Perrine was sent back down to the AA after batting.171 in 44 games. He played in the Minor [League Baseball|minor leagues] until 1915. Perrine was one of several baseball players in the first half of the 20th century to be nicknamed "Nig".
